site stats

C++ shell sort

WebAug 27, 2016 · Shell Sort is also known as diminishing increment sort, it is one of the oldest sorting algorithms invented by Donald L. Shell (1959.) This algorithm uses insertion sort on the large interval of elements to sort. Then the interval of sorting keeps on decreasing in a sequence until the interval reaches 1. These intervals are known as gap sequence. WebNov 28, 2024 · 1. Definisi Sorting pada C++. 2. Bubble Sort. 3. Quick Sort. 4. Metode Maximum/Minimum Sort. 5. Metode Shell Sort. 6. Metode Merge Sort. 7. Metode Insertion Sort . 1. Definisi Sorting pada C++. Pengurutan (sorting) adalah proses mengatur sekumpulan objek menurut urutan atau susunan tertentu.

华为OD机试真题 C++ 实现【带传送阵的矩阵游离】【2024 Q2

WebJun 22, 2024 · Basic Definition, Theory and Idea. Shell Sort sometimes also referred as Diminished Increment sort, It uses Insertion Sort but, with some optimizations. The intuitive Optimization is : It divides the Main array/list in smaller lists and perform insertion sort on each of those list, to sort them. The idea is to arrange the list of elements so ... WebExplanation for the article: http://quiz.geeksforgeeks.org/shellsort/This video is contributed by Arjun Tyagi. gamecock twitter football https://modernelementshome.com

C++ Program for Shell Sort - AlphaCodingSkills - Java

WebSupport Simple Snippets by Donations -Google Pay UPI ID - tanmaysakpal11@okiciciPayPal - paypal.me/tanmaysakpal11-----... WebApr 8, 2024 · Syntax of find () The find () function is a member of the string class in C++. It has the following syntax: string::size_type find (const string& str, size_type pos = 0) const noexcept; Let's break down this syntax into its component parts: string::size_type is a data type that represents the size of a string. It is an unsigned integer type. WebShell sort is a highly efficient sorting algorithm and is based on insertion sort algorithm. This algorithm avoids large shifts as in case of insertion sort, if the smaller value is to the far right and has to be moved to the far left. Shell short is an improved and efficient version of Insertion Sort rather while compared with other Sorting ... black eagle accommodation

Shell Sort Algorithm: Everything You Need to Know - Simplilearn…

Category:shell sort sequence implementation in C++ - Stack Overflow

Tags:C++ shell sort

C++ shell sort

Shell Sort in C and C++ : r/Technotoken - Reddit

WebJun 18, 2014 · Shell sort seems more consistent for all cases, while quicksort is faster in average, but it hits bad cases quite often (but all this is general talk for large sets). The use case is to sort lists in RPL. The algorithm itself would be sorting only the pointers to the objects, and generic objects will have to be compared with the RPL operator '>'.

C++ shell sort

Did you know?

WebThis video is based on shell sort Algorithm. This Shell sort in data structures tutorial helps beginners learn sorting algorithms. The video also covers prac... Shell sort is an unstable sorting algorithm because this algorithm does not examine the elements lying in between the intervals. See more Shell sort is used when: 1. calling a stack is overhead. uClibclibrary uses this sort. 2. recursion exceeds a limit. bzip2compressor uses it. 3. Insertion sort does not perform … See more

WebC++ Shell 2.0 © cpp.sh 2014-2024 buy me a coffe old version still available here (for a limited time).here (for a limited time). WebThe point about shell sort is that the initial sorts, acting on elements at larger increments apart involve fewer elements, even considering a worst-case scenario. At the larger increments, "far-away" elements are swapped so that the number of inversions is dramatically reduced. At the later sorts using smaller increments, the behavior then ...

WebMar 13, 2024 · The sorting techniques allow us to sort our data structures in a specific order and arrange the elements either in ascending or descending order. We have seen … WebApr 6, 2024 · To create a vector in C++, you need to include the header file and declare a vector object. Here's an example: #include std::vectormy_vector. …

http://json.jsrun.net/fBcKp

WebOct 16, 2024 · Sort an array of elements using the Shell sort algorithm, a diminishing increment sort. The Shell sort (also known as Shellsort or Shell's method) is named after its inventor, Donald Shell, who published the algorithm in 1959. Shell sort is a sequence of interleaved insertion sorts based on an increment sequence. black eagle adventure 2.2 gtx ws lowWebMay 4, 2015 · I am reading about shell sort in Algorithms in C++ by Robert Sedwick. Here outer loop to change the increments leads to this compact shellsort implementation, which uses the increment sequence 1 4 13 40 121 364 1093 3280 9841 . . . . gamecock vestWebI know the difference between insertion sort and shell sort. Insertion sort compares every single item with all the rest elements of the list, whereas shell sort uses a gap to compare items far apart from each other, and then recursively closes in the gap until all elements are sorted. Obviously, shell sort is more effective when the array ... black eagle 50hWebFeb 18, 2024 · ShellSort is an in-place comparison sort. It is mainly a variation of sorting by exchange (bubble sort) or sorting by insertion (insertion sort). This algorithm avoids … gamecock under armourhttp://json.jsrun.net/fBcKp black eagle ag solutionsWebMay 3, 2015 · I have corrected and updated my answer with an example. You could very well select 10 or 11 to be used. Don't choose it too big, Insertion Sort (on which Shell … black eagle adventureWebMay 16, 2024 · Itulah beberapa contoh program dan source code radix sort, shell sort, merge sort, dan quick sort. Jika masih bingung dengan materi diatas, silahkan bertanya melalui kolom komentar dibawah ini. Mudah – … black eagle adventure 2.2 gtx low/cobalt-fire